About the Role

Scientia Academy has an exciting opportunity for an individual to join the school and REAch2 Academy Trust as an Office Coordinator  to ensure the daily administration and smooth running of the school office. The office is the hub of the school where a wide range of demands need to be met to a very high professional standard. The key purpose of this role is to ensure the daily administration and smooth running of the school office working alongside the Headteacher and Trust Shared Services Teams.

The Office Coordinator will actively embrace the REAch2 Academy Trust’s Touchstones, and through the delivery of the strategic priorities, strive for equity, equality, and inclusion for all.

There will be a strong focus through the work of the Office Coordinator on the Trust’s commitment to sustainability and the enhanced use of technology, to support both the delivery of education and drive to improve the efficiency of systems and processes.

Candidates should have:

  • experience working in a general office / administration environment
  • experience working with and be proficient in Microsoft Office packages such as Word and Excel
  • experience of reception work – being first point of contact with customers and visitors
  • good spoken and written communication skills
  • good attention to detail
  • the ability to compose a clear message via email or letter
  • the ability to meet deadlines
  • the ability to work effectively with a wide range of people
